Ingredients

Scale
  • 1 lb boneless, skinless chicken thighs
  • 1 lb large shrimp, peeled
  • 1 cup long-grain rice
  • 1 medium onion, chopped
  • 2 cloves garlic, minced
  • 1 cup bell peppers (mixed colors), chopped
  • 1 cup tomato sauce
  • 2 cups low-sodium chicken broth
  • 2 tbsp olive oil
  • 1 tsp cumin
  • 1 tsp smoked paprika
  • Fresh cilantro for garnish

Instructions

  1. Marinate chicken thighs in lime juice, cumin, and paprika for at least 30 minutes.
  2. In a large skillet, heat olive oil over medium heat. Sauté onions and bell peppers until softened (about 5 minutes).
  3. Add marinated chicken to the skillet; cook until golden brown on all sides (approximately 10 minutes). Remove chicken temporarily.
  4. Add shrimp to the skillet; cook until pink (3-4 minutes).
  5. Stir in rice, tomato sauce, and broth; combine well and bring to a gentle simmer.
  6. Cover and simmer on low heat for about 20-25 minutes until rice absorbs liquid.
